The Lab Exports Human Circulatory System Model displays the arterial and venous systems together with the heart, lungs, liver, spleen, kidneys and a partial skeleton. This combined presentation helps learners observe where major blood vessels lie in relation to organs and skeletal landmarks.

The anatomy is appropriately coloured and numbered for structured identification. The model is mounted on a base and supplied with a key card, making it suitable for repeated instructor-led demonstrations. It forms part of the Lab Exports range of human-system anatomy models.

How to Use the Human Circulatory System Model

Place the base on a stable, well-lit demonstration surface.

Use the key card to identify the numbered structures.

Begin with the heart as the central reference point.

Trace represented arterial pathways away from the heart.

Trace represented venous pathways toward the heart.

Relate the vessels to the lungs, liver, spleen, kidneys and partial skeleton.

Handling note: Use the product only as an educational model. Do not bend vessel representations, pull projecting parts or lift the model by an organ or skeletal feature.
